Earlier I received a CP566 notice saying that I should submit the additional documents by Sep 1st. I consulted couple of tax experts with that notice and they said I need to send original passport along with the notice. I mailed them the original passport along with notice on Aug 23rd and I see that it delivered to Delivered, Front Desk/Reception/Mail Room AUSTIN, TX 73301 on Aug 26th. I used certified mail option and I got the return receipt also. But now I received CP567 notice saying that ITIN is rejected because of not providing additional documents. Meaning that looks like they did not receive my passport/they might lost it somewhere. It is surprising that I received return receipt of the passport delivery and now I received reject notice.

I am in the same situation, my spouse's passport was delivered to "Front Desk/Reception/Mail Room AUSTIN, TX 73301", It was automatically routed by USPS to this addess, even though the correct address was written on the mail , and it was supposed to deliver at 78714 code. And now rejection notice that the document was not received.
Any update on your side? you received the ITIN number or the passport back?
I received ITIN Number after 10 weeks, and after 1 week passport was received too.
Redirection to AUSTIN, TX 73301 is fine. No need to worry, just wait for 10 to 12 weeks.
